description - Princeton women gather in the Seth Nichols House on Worcester Road to make bandages and supplies for French wounded soldiers. Mary Nichols, owner of the house, stands in the rear. Sadie B. description - Two sisters, Mary Alice Roper (b. 1904-03-07) and Julia Adeline Roper (b. 1905-06-24) were born in Princeton, Massachusetts. They were the daughters of William Marshall Roper, Jr. and Julia Alice (Bennett) Roper (m. 1901-10-08). description - Edith Belle Roper (b. 1880-09-22) was the daughter of William Marshall Roper and Mary Abbie (Davis) Roper (m. 1869-11-18). William operated a sawmill that primarily produced chair stock with his father, brother, and later his two sons. description - Redemption Rock Association members gathered to commemorate the release of Mary Rowlandson of Lancaster, Massachusetts in 1879. Mary Rowlandson was taken captive during King Philip's War on February 10, 1676 by the Narragansett Indians.
